Chapter 11 Wireless LAN Figure 67 Network > Wireless LAN 2.4G/5G > General: Static WEP The following table describes the wireless LAN security labels in this screen. Table 40 Network > Wireless LAN 2.4G/5G > General: Static WEP LABEL Security Mode PassPhrase DESCRIPTION Select Static WEP to enable data encryption. Enter a Passphrase (up to 26 printable characters) and click Generate. A passphrase functions like a password. In WEP security mode, it is further converted by the NBG into a complicated string that is referred to as the "key". This key is requested from all devices wishing to connect to a wireless network. WEP Encryption Select 64-bit WEP or 128-bit WEP. Authentication Method This dictates the length of the security key that the network is going to use. Select Auto or Shared Key from the drop-down list box. This field specifies whether the wireless clients have to provide the WEP key to login to the wireless client. Keep this setting at Auto unless you want to force a key verification before communication between the wireless client and the NBG occurs. ASCII Hex Select Shared Key to force the clients to provide the WEP key prior to communication. Select this option in order to enter ASCII characters as WEP key. Select this option in order to enter hexadecimal characters as a WEP key. The preceding "0x", that identifies a hexadecimal key, is entered automatically. NBG6515 User's Guide 87
